
 a		{ color: #003366 }
 
 td, body	{
  font-size: 12px; font-family: Arial, Helvetica, sans-serif; 
  scrollbar-base-color:#8C8CC6;
  scrollbar-3dlight-color:#FFFFFF;
  scrollbar-arrow-color:#FFFFFF;
  scrollbar-darkshadow-color:#000000;
  scrollbar-face-color:#4A51A7;
  scrollbar-highlight-color:#FFFFFF;
  scrollbar-shadow-color:#000000;
  scrollbar-track-color:#FFFFFF;
  }

body{
text-align:center;
} 

#main {
width:930px;
margin-left:auto;
margin-right:auto;
position:relative;
}
 .menu { font-size: 11px; text-decoration: none; color: #003366 } 
 .menu:hover { text-decoration: underline}
 .noul { color: #000000;  text-decoration: none }
 .noul:hover { text-decoration: underline }
 .footer { font-size: 10px; color: #666666 }
 .seitenzaehler { font-size: 11px; text-decoration: none; color: #003366 }
 .seitenzaehler:visited { font-size: 11px; color: #003366;  text-decoration: underline}
 .seitenzaehler:hover { text-decoration: underline }
 .t_inn {
	border-left-style: solid;
	border-bottom-style: solid;
	border-bottom-color: #e8e8e8;
	border-left-color: #e8e8e8;
	border-bottom-width: 1px;
	border-left-width: 1px;
	
}
.tab_out {
	border: 1px solid #e8e8e8;
}
.tab_bottom {
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#e8e8e8;
	
}
.tab_top {
	border-top-width: 1px;
	border-top-style: solid;
	border-top-color: #e8e8e8;
	
}
.tab_left {
	border-left-width: 1px;
	border-left-style: solid;
	border-left-color: #e8e8e8;
}

.tab_right {
	border-right-width: 1px;
	border-right-style: solid;
	border-right-color: #e8e8e8;
}

.tab_right_bottom {
	border-right-width: 1px;
	border-right-style: solid;
	border-right-color: #e8e8e8;
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#e8e8e8;
}
.tab_all {
border-color:#e8e8e8;
border-width:1px;
border-style:solid;
}

.tab_solo_left {
border-left-color:#FFFFFF;
border-left-width:2px;
border-left-style:solid;
}

.headline_left {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10pt;
	font-style: normal;
	color: #FFFFFF;
	font-weight: bold;
	background-color: #4A51A7;
	height: 20px;
}

.headline_content {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10pt;
	font-style: normal;
	color: #FFFFFF;
	font-weight: bold;
	background-color: #FFB300;
	height: 20px;
}

.headline_weiss {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10pt;
	font-style: normal;
	color: #FFFFFF;
	font-weight: bold;
	background-color: #4A51A7;
	height: 20px;
}

.headline_right {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10pt;
	font-style: normal;
	color: #FFFFFF;
	font-weight: bold;
	background-color: #FFB300;
	height: 20px;
}

.block_text {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: normal;
	color: #000000;
	text-align: justify;
	margin: 0px;
	padding-left: 3px;
	padding-right: 3px;
	padding-top: 3px;
}

.block_text_kreise {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-weight: normal;
	color: #FFFFFF;
	text-align: left;
	margin: 0px;
	padding-left: 5px;
	padding-right: 5px;
	padding-top: 5px;
	background-color: #4A51A7;
}

.regionensuche {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 9px;
	color: #003366;
	text-align: justify;
}

.teasertext {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 9px;
	color: #003366;
	text-align:justify; 
	margin-top:10px; 
	padding:3px;
}

.hinweistext {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 9px;
	color: #003366;	
}

.bild_link {
cursor:pointer;
}



.alttext {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#333399;
	background-color: #FFCC33;
}

.button {
	text-decoration: none;
	border: none;
	background-color: #FFFFFF;
}
.map_text {
background-color:#ffffff;
font-family:"Arial";
font-size:10px;
}
.map_text2 {
background-color:#ffffff;
font-family:"Arial";
font-size:10px;
}
.map_tab {
width:350px;
}
.map_static {
border-color:#000000;
border-left-width:0px;border-right-width:0px;border-top-width:1px;border-bottom-width:0px;
border-style:solid;
}
.map_static_bottom {
border-color:#000000;
border-left-width:0px;border-right-width:0px;border-top-width:0px;border-bottom-width:1px;
border-style:solid;
}
.map_static_bottom_left {
border-color:#000000;
border-left-width:1px;border-right-width:0px;border-top-width:0px;border-bottom-width:1px;
border-style:solid;
}
.map_static_bottom_right {
border-color:#000000;
border-left-width:0px;border-right-width:1px;border-top-width:0px;border-bottom-width:1px;
border-style:solid;
}
.map_static_left {
border-color:#000000;
border-left-width:1px;border-right-width:0px;border-top-width:0px;border-bottom-width:0px;
border-style:solid;
}
.map_static_right {
border-color:#000000;
border-left-width:0px;border-right-width:1px;border-top-width:0px;border-bottom-width:0px;
border-style:solid;
}
.map_static_image {
border-color:#000000;
border-left-width:1px;border-right-width:1px;border-top-width:1px;border-bottom-width:1px;
border-style:solid;
}
.text_normal_weiss {
color:#ffffff;
font-family:"Arial";
font-size:10pt;
font-weight:bold;
}
.form_start {
width:150px;
}	

<!-- Popup Kalender Style -->

.TESTcpYearNavigation,
	.TESTcpMonthNavigation
			{
			background-color:#4A51A7; 
			text-align:center;
			vertical-align:center;
			text-decoration:none;
			color:#FFFFFF;
			font-weight:bold;
			}
	.TESTcpDayColumnHeader,
	.TESTcpYearNavigation,
	.TESTcpMonthNavigation,
	.TESTcpCurrentMonthDate,
	.TESTcpCurrentMonthDateDisabled,
	.TESTcpOtherMonthDate,
	.TESTcpOtherMonthDateDisabled,
	.TESTcpCurrentDate,
	.TESTcpCurrentDateDisabled,
	.TESTcpTodayText,
	.TESTcpTodayTextDisabled,
	.TESTcpText
			{
			font-family:arial;
			font-size:8pt;
			}
	TD.TESTcpDayColumnHeader
			{
			text-align:right;
			border:solid 1px #4A51A7;
			border-width:0 0 1 0;
			background-color:#e8e8e8
			}
	.TESTcpCurrentMonthDate,
	.TESTcpOtherMonthDate,
			{
			text-align:right;
			text-decoration:none;
			background-color:#e8e8e8;
			}
	.TESTcpCurrentMonthDate,
	.TESTcpOtherMonthDate,
	.TESTcpCurrentDate
			{
			text-align:right;
			text-decoration:none;
			}
	.TESTcpCurrentMonthDateDisabled,
	.TESTcpOtherMonthDateDisabled,
	.TESTcpCurrentDateDisabled
			{
			color:#D0D0D0;
			text-align:right;
			text-decoration:line-through;
			background-color:#e8e8e8;
			}
	.TESTcpCurrentMonthDate
			{
			color:#4A51A7;
			font-weight:bold;
			background-color:#e8e8e8;
			}
	.TESTcpCurrentDate
			{
			color: #FFFFFF;
			font-weight:bold;
			}
	.TESTcpOtherMonthDate
			{
			color:#aeaeae;
			}
			<!-- Rahmen um gewähltes Datum -->
	TD.TESTcpCurrentDate 
			{
			color:#FFFFFF;
			background-color: #4A51A7;
			border-width:1;
			border:solid 1px #000000;
			}
	TD.TESTcpCurrentDateDisabled
			{
			border-width:1;
			border:solid thin #FFAAAA;
			}
	TD.TESTcpTodayText,
	TD.TESTcpTodayTextDisabled
			{
			border:solid 1px #4A51A7;
			border-width:1 0 0 0;
			}
	A.TESTcpTodayText,
	SPAN.TESTcpTodayTextDisabled
			{
			height:20px;
			}
	A.TESTcpTodayText
			{
			color:#4A51A7;
			font-weight:bold;
			background-color:#e8e8e8;
			}
	SPAN.TESTcpTodayTextDisabled
			{
			color:#D0D0D0;
			background-color:#e8e8e8;
			}
	.TESTcpBorder
			{
			border:none;
			background-color:#e8e8e8;
			}
			
<!-- Kalender ende 


-->			

/************************************/
/************** definiert die linkfarbe der stadtlinks auf den kartenseiten*********************/
/************** definiert die linkfarbe der stadtlinks auf den kartenseiten*********************/
#stadtlinks a {
	text-decoration: none;
	color: #B3B5BF;
}
#stadtlinks a:hover  {
	text-decoration: underline;
}


/* begin styles fuer golfbilder */
.golfBild:hover {
	position: relative;
}
* html .golfBild:hover {
	left: -105px;
}
.golfBild img {
	border: 1px solid black;
}
.golfBild .bildKlein, .golfThumb {
	float: left; 
	margin-right: 3px; 
	margin-bottom: 3px;
}
.golfBild .bildGross { 
	display:none; 
}
.golfBild:hover .bildGross {
	display: block;
	z-index: 11;
	position: absolute;
}
/* // end styles fuer "golfbilder" */

/* WM Pics */
#content {
	padding: 4px;
}
#content p {
	text-align: justify;
}
#content img {
	border: 1px solid black;
}
#content img.links {
	margin-right: 5px;
	float: left;
}
#content img.rechts {
	margin-left: 5px;
	float: right;
}